Remote Architecture Job In Engineering And Architecture

Acoustic Echo Cancellation

Find more Architecture remote jobs posted recently Worldwide

Acoustic Echo Cancellation is a standard yet tricky task: on a computer with laud speaker turned on, my microphone will capture both my voice and what played from the my computer laud speaker. You are asked to write a quality program that removes all from the laud speaker and only records my voice.

Your baseline delivery shall be a portable code runnable on both Windows and Android, given proper APIs for back-sampling speaker sound and for recording microphone.

What makes the code a bit more tricky is: actually we do NOT have the typical back-sampling of speaker. Instead, we have a loosely time aligned speaker out audio stream (from higher level Windows APIs). As a compensation, we are allowed to play out, together with the speaker audio, some ultrasound (at 20khz-22khz) which is identifiable from the recording mic (48khz sampling rate). You might want to take advantage of that by playing out some time sync ultrasonic tones.

We limit ourselves to a mono mic, for now.

Further details to be discussed in Q/A.
About the recuiter
Member since Mar 14, 2020
Mk.palsania
from New Jersey, United States

Open for hiringApply before - May 29, 2024

Work from Anywhere

40 hrs / week

Fixed Type

Remote Job

$479.04

Cost

Offer to work on this project closes in 13 days!
Are you interested in this Opportunity?

Looking for help? Checkout our video tutorial
How to search and apply for jobs

How to apply? Do you have more questions about the Job?
See frequently asked questions

Similar Projects

Fix wifi adapter issue on ubuntu 18

Need to fix wifi adapter issue on ubuntu 18. I tried a lot from help on internet, but not working. It was working before I restarted my PC. LAN is working so anyone how has fixed this before, need to take TeamViewer to fix.

Thanks

Need a Middle+ DevOps specialist to configure k8s on baremetal

We are looking for a devops specialist to configure kubernetes on baremetal and other tasks.

Android Developer needed for creating Video Editing App

I am looking for a talented Android Developer who is proficient in making great video editing apps.

- The developer should have expertise in creating less sizeable apps having fast performance.
- That person should be very cooperative an...read more

AWS Infrastructure Setup for Microservices projects

Create custom VPC,
Private and Public subnets, NACL,
Nat Gateway, Internet gateway, Route tables.
Create RDS Single AZ setup
Create multiple S3 buckets and
use KMS to encrypt data at rest.

Decrypt PEDANT file (ransomware)

My files was encrypted by Pedant ransomware,

MYID.PEDANT

please if you can help me to recorver my important files will be great.